Main Tasks:

As a Cybersecurity Auditor, you will be responsible for evaluating and improving the effectiveness of our information security systems and processes.

Your key duties will include:

  • Conducting comprehensive audits of our internal subsidiaries or 3rd parties, based on cybersecurity policies, procedures and controls to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and banking industry standards;
  • Identifying security-related vulnerabilities and weaknesses in BNPP subsidiaries/3rd parties’ information systems and recommending appropriate corrective actions;
  • Collaborating with cross-functional teams to develop and implement robust security measures that protect our organization's data and assets;
  • Preparing detailed audit reports, presenting findings, and providing actionable recommendations to senior management;
  • Staying up-to-date with the latest cybersecurity trends, threats, and technologies to ensure our organization remains at the forefront of security best practices.
